At least 12 people were killed and several injured on Friday 31/5 in a mass shooting at a government building in the USA state of Virginia.

Police said the suspect, a long-term and current Virginia Beach city employee, fired “indiscriminately” in a public utilities building.
The gunman, whose identity was not released, was killed in an exchange of gunfire with police. Officials said an officer was wounded when a bullet struck his vest.
The attack began shortly after 16:00 (20:00 GMT), at Virginia Beach Municipal Center, in an area which is home to a number of city government buildings. The area was put into lockdown by police and employees were evacuated.
One of the victims was shot outside in a car, and the rest were found over three floors of the government building.
Four officers entered the building and located the gunman inside and “immediately engaged” The attacker was then killed in an extended exchange of gunfire.
